WebHere the shell interprets the << operator as an instruction to read input until it finds a line containing the specified delimiter. All the input lines up to the line containing the delimiter are then fed into the standard input of the command. The delimiter tells the shell that the here document has completed. Web8.2.1. Using the read built-in command. The read built-in command is the counterpart of the echo and printf commands. The syntax of the read command is as follows:. read [options] NAME1 NAME2 ... NAMEN. One line is read from the standard input, or from the file descriptor supplied as an argument to the -u option. WebMar 7, 2024 · We can make a Bash script interactive by prompting a user for input. This can be done from the command line, with our script waiting for user input in order to proceed further. The principal way to do this is via the read command. Although it is also possible to read input in the form of command line arguments that are passed to the Bash script …
